Hello everyone,

As mentioned in subject, I am working on a project in which SNMP protocol is to be implemented. I have written a code for SNMP Protocol which is working fine with the LPC1768 controller board. I am able to receive all the data(string) which is sent from controller to PC using ethernet. These strings are written in MIB_STR() function of MIB Table,

 

for eg.

const MIB_ENTRY snmp_mib[] = {

/* ---------- System MIB ----------- */

/* SysDescr Entry */
{ MIB_OCTET_STR | MIB_ATR_RO,
8, {OID0(1,3), 6,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 0}, 
MIB_STR("Hello World"),  //as this string i am not updating while execution of main function so it is working fine
NULL }

};

but when i am trying to update current values of parameters in place of string, it is not allowing to do that.

 

for eg.

const MIB_ENTRY snmp_mib[] = {

/* ---------- System MIB ----------- */

/* SysDescr Entry */
{ MIB_OCTET_STR | MIB_ATR_RO,
8, {OID0(1,3), 6, 1, 2, 1, 1, 1, 0}, 
MIB_STR(Temp[1]),  //error: initializer element is not a compile-time constant
NULL }

};

Temperature values are saved in an array in ASCII format. 

so, I am planning to Copy the same MIB Table to RAM when controller starts execution of code & then i want controller to read MIB table from the specific RAM address area so, i can update Current values of parameters at respective RAM Address locations.

may i know how to make controller to read from Specific RAM address location instead of  FLASH memory while execution of main function.

Hello, Xiangjun_rong,

I am using Keil uVision 4 IDE and MIB_STR() is declared as a macro in Net_Config.h file

macro declaration in Net_Config.h is as given below.


/* SNMP-MIB Macros */
#define MIB_STR(s) sizeof(s)-1, s
